Sexual Differentiation of Behavior: The Foundation of a Developmental Model of Psychosexuality

Richard C. Friedman

Weill Cornell Medical College, Columbia University Center for Psychoanalytic Training and Research, rcf2{at}columbia.edu

Jennifer I. Downey

Department of Psychiatry, Columbia University, Columbia University Center for Psychoanalytic Training and Research, jid1{at}columbia.edu

The sexual differentiation of the brain and behavior occurs as the result of prenatal hormonal influences. Knowledge of this area is helpful for the construction of an appropriately modern psychoanalytically informed developmental paradigm of psychosexuality.
